Each
year the Defense Security Cooperation Agency (DSCA) sends out a call toSecurity
Cooperation Organizations (SCOs), Combatant Commands (CCMDs), Military
Department, and Country Program Directors (CPDs), addressing the
requirements and timeline for estimating future year FMS sales.
To reduce staffing and redundancy DSCA will use the FMS Forecast to extract
Javits Report data.
The information provided is used by DSCA to meet DoD Congressional reporting
requirements, support the Department of State's Foreign Operations budget
request to the Congress, and to ensure that the Security Assistance community
is properly resourced to meet workloads associated with future FMS.

Each country's submission should be reviewed by CCMDs and
each individually marked FOR OFFICIAL USE ONLY.
When the individual country reports are combined the compilation of the
data requires the report be CONFIDENTIAL.
